Installation Instructions:

WARNING: To reduce the risk of fire or electric shock do not expose the unit to rain or moisture. 
This installation should be made by qualified service personnel and should conform to all local codes.

HubSat4Di Passive UTP Transceiver Hub with Integral Isolated Camera Power.

1.  Mount unit in the desired location. Mark and predrill holes in the wall to line up with the top two keyholes 

 

in the enclosure. Install two upper fasteners and screws in the wall with the screw heads protruding. Place 

 

the enclosure’s upper keyholes over the two upper screws; level and secure. Mark the position of the lower 

 

two holes. Remove the enclosure. Drill the lower holes and install two fasteners. Place the enclosure’s 

 

upper keyholes over the two upper screws. Install the two lower screws and make sure to tighten all 

 screws 

(Enclosure Dimensions, pg. 12)

. Secure green wire lead to earth ground.

2.  Set illuminated master power disconnect circuit breaker to the [OFF] position 

(Fig. 4a, pg. 8)

3.  Connect 115VAC 50/60Hz to the black and white flying leads of open frame transformer. Secure ground

 

wire (Green) to earth ground 

(Fig. 5, pg. 9)

. The power LEDs (Green) for Channels 1-4 of the HubSat4Di

 

will illuminate when AC power is present 

(Fig. 1e, pg. 6)

4.  S elect 24VAC or 28VAC power output for each of the Channels 1-4 on HubSat4Di 

(Fig. 4, pg. 8)

 with the 

 

corresponding output voltage switches. Select OFF position when servicing or installing individual cameras 

 

(Fig. 1d, pg. 6)

.

5.  Connect the BNC video outputs marked [Video 1-4] on HubSat4Di to the corresponding video inputs on 

 

the head end equipment (DVR) 

(Fig. 1a, pg. 6)

.

6.  Connect terminals marked [+ Data –] on HubSat4Di (polarity must be observed) to the RS422/RS485 

 

output of the head end equipment (DVR) 

(Fig. 1f, pg. 6)

. When using fixed cameras disregard this step.

Input:

•  115VAC, 50/60Hz, 1.25A.

Video:

•  Four (4) channels of quality video over twisted pair

  up to a distance of 750  ft. per channel.

•  Four (4) 75 Ohm video outputs.

Data:

•  RS422/RS485 data input.

Power:

•  Individually selectable 24VAC or 28VAC power 

  outputs with OFF position.

•  Unit provides up to 1A max. per channel not to

  exceed a total of 4A maximum current.

•  Individual electronically isolated outputs.

Power 

(cont.)

:

•  PTC protected outputs are rated @ 1A per channel.

•  Surge suppression.

Visual Indicators:

•  Four (4) power LED indicators.

Enclosure Dimensions 

(H x W x D)

:

  8.5” x 7.5” x 3.5” (215.9mm x 190.5mm x 88.9mm).

Optional Accessories:

•  Video Balun/Combiners:

  -  HubWayAv - for use with 24VAC cameras.

  -  HubWayAv2 - for use with 24VAC cameras.

  -  HubWayDv - for use with 12VDC cameras.

Overview:

Altronix HubSat4Di Passive UTP Transceiver Hub with Integral Isolated Camera Power transmits UTP video, 

RS422/RS485 data and power over a single CAT-5 or higher structured cable. Unit provides 4 camera channels 

in a wall mount enclosure. Video transmission range is up to 750 ft. max. per channel. Units are compatible with 

AC and/or DC fixed or PTZ cameras when utilizing Altronix HubWayAv or HubWayDv Video Balun/Combiners. In 

addition, the unit features individually selectable 24VAC or 28VAC electronically isolated PTC protected outputs 

with surge suppression. Optionally, the HubSat4Di can be used as an accessory module to transmit video from 

up to 4 cameras over a single CAT-5 or higher structured cable back to the HubWay, HubWayLD or HubWayLDH 

Passive and Active UTP Transceiver Hubs. In addition, the HubSat4Di provides power to these cameras locally to 

eliminate the possibility of voltage drop associated with long cable runs.
